Unpacking the Icon: The Nike Air Max 90
Before diving into the specifics of our featured shoe, let's establish the context of the Nike Air Max 90 itself. Released in 1990 as a successor to the Air Max 1, the Air Max 90 (initially known as the Air Max III) built upon its predecessor's revolutionary visible Air unit technology, enhancing both comfort and aesthetic appeal. The design, spearheaded by Tinker Hatfield, introduced a more robust, layered upper construction, incorporating premium materials like leather and suede for durability and a luxurious feel. The iconic mudguard, a prominent feature running along the midsole, added to its rugged yet stylish profile.
The Air Max 90's success transcends fleeting trends. Its enduring popularity is attributable to several key factors:
* Visible Air Technology: The exposed Air unit in the heel provides superior cushioning and shock absorption, contributing to exceptional comfort during extended wear. This technological innovation wasn't just functional; it became a signature design element, instantly recognizable and visually striking.
* Versatile Design: The Air Max 90's design is incredibly versatile. It seamlessly transitions from casual everyday wear to more stylish outfits, making it a staple in many wardrobes. Its clean lines and classic silhouette allow it to complement a wide range of styles and personal aesthetics.
* Material Quality and Construction: The use of high-quality materials like leather and suede, particularly in premium releases, ensures durability and longevity. The meticulous construction contributes to the shoe's overall quality and reinforces its reputation as a long-lasting investment.
* Colorways and Collaborations: Nike has consistently released a vast array of colorways, catering to diverse tastes and preferences. From classic OG color schemes to bold, contemporary designs and highly sought-after collaborations with prominent designers and brands, the Air Max 90 offers a virtually endless range of options for collectors and enthusiasts.
